In January 1943, an Electra piloted by Alaskan bush Pilot Harold Gillam crashed in foul weather on its way from Seattle to Anchorage. Gillam died trying to find help for the survivors. ‘Final Flight’ to be released soon
A new book, “Final Flight: The Mystery of a WWII Plane Crash and the Frozen Airmen in the High Sierra,” will be released in September. New book on Vietnam helicopter pilots released
Just released is “The Red Tavern,” the true story of the silent preachers of the First Air Cavalry Division, who piloted the Huey helicopters that were the beginning and end of every Vietnam story. ‘The Book of Skydiving Formations’ released
Just released is “The Book of Skydiving Formations.” The book covers all group sizes from two-ways through 20-ways. There are more than 1,000 formations in all.
